Hydro Quebec is a Canadian company developing lithium metal sheets for lithium metal batteries. They can manufacture said sheets down to 20 micron thickness.

Blue Solutions
Blue Solutions is a French company that produces Li-ion batteries that employ a lithium metal anode and a polymer electrolyte. These rechargeable batteries are used in Bolloré's Bluecar, an electric microcar with a 250 km driving range.

All eyes on Supercapacitors
Supercapacitors (ultracapacitors) are now center stage for designers of electronics and particularly power circuits. This is because they are improving faster than the batteries and electrolytic capacitors they increasingly replace. More subtly, they reduce the need for and danger from lithium-ion batteries.
